Loïc Pera

Clermont-Ferrand, Auvergne-Rhône-Alpes, France
Ride

Motivation post tour de France

  • Distance
    28.2 km
  • Time
    1h 21m 20s
  • Elevation
    751 m

1 Photo

6 Comments

    Segments

    The #1 app for runners and cyclists